Transaction 91060f7a1924754fc0bee6c44a88a60589c7dc48aed06c0d2f90b2131c26800e
1 Input
1 Output
-
91060f7a1924754fc0bee6c44a88a60589c7dc48aed06c0d2f90b2131c26800e:0
- value
- 593578
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bcdea45be1ef58339f3bec2336d4b36da2c9b4d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M3DfFC8M51YyBUmQPuzUayDUE6aMpDNkg